Description:
Open Workbench from terminal (desktop file is totally borked, even with 'run from terminal')...

Reverse a db from local mysql.
Make a few minor alterations to the model
Save the model.
Stop workbench (there is no 'close' on the current model).
Restart mysql-workbench, get all the "no theme" errors...
Select File->Open->selct a .mwb file
Application hangs.  Selecting 'close window' on the desktop brings "This application is not responding... Force Quit" ...
